    Vladimir Leonidovich Murawjoff/ Muraviev (1861-1940)

    Count Vladimir Leonidovich Murawjoff was born in 1861 in St. Petersburg. He studied at the Imperial Academy of Arts in St. Petersburg under the renowned landscape painters Mikhail Klodt and Julius von Klever. He soon became a leading Russian painter of hunting themes. His passion was not only painting but poetry as well in which he expresses his love for the Russian nature that is on the other hand also reflected in his atmospherically charged landscapes.
